**First Day Checklist — Fire-Drill Roll Call (Contractors)**

All visiting contractors at the Brindle House site must be accounted for during fire drills. On arrival, sign the contractor register at the front desk so the warden's roll-call sheet includes your name. When the alarm sounds, leave by the nearest marked exit and assemble at Muster Point C in the rear yard. Wait for your name to be called; do not leave until released. To reach the yard through the east stairwell door, use the pass code below.

turnstile pass: bdg-FVNQRS-72965873

### Migrating scheduled jobs to Trellivane

We are retiring the legacy cron host and moving all scheduled jobs to the Trellivane workflow engine. For support: jobs now retry automatically with backoff, and failures page the owning team instead of silently stalling. Expect fewer "job didn't run" tickets, but more retry-related noise during the cutover week. Retry behavior is governed by these constants.

tuning table, faduf-baduf:
PRIORITIES = {
    "ulavan": 191,
    "silys": 750,
    "goriel": 238,
    "kelmir": 66,
    "wendor": 432,
}

Runbook: Purgatron retention sweeper. Runs nightly, deleting records past their retention window. If the sweep stalls, check the lease table for stuck locks before restarting. Never skip more than two consecutive runs without notifying the data governance group. Full escalation steps and lock-clearing commands are documented on the internal page.

operations page: https://jenkins.zemvarcloud.local/job/merge_requests/repo/build/73930b4b30f0a8ed

Heads up since you're on call this week: this change bumps the Brineport pool settings, and if the API tier gets chatty you'll see connection waits before you see errors. The pool now evicts idle connections faster, which saves the database but means cold bursts pay a reconnect tax. If latency spikes, check pool saturation first, not the query log. Everything tunable lives in one config block, and the current values are these.

limits module of fahaf-kagug:
WEIGHTS = {
    "zorok": 591,
    "fendor": 661,
    "belix": 110,
}